How many microvolts are in one kilovolt?
Exactly 1,000,000,000. Every figure on this page is that one number multiplied by your input, so the only rounding is at the display step.
What is the formula to convert kilovolts to microvolts?
microvolts = kilovolts × 1,000,000,000. Reversed, kilovolts = microvolts ÷ 1,000,000,000, which is the same as multiplying by 1e-09.
Which is the bigger unit, the kilovolt or the microvolt?
The kilovolt. One kilovolt equals 1e+09 microvolts.
What does this quantity actually measure?
Both units measure the electrical potential difference driving a current. That is why a single factor is enough: there is no temperature offset and no material property involved, unlike conversions that cross between different quantities.

| Quantity | kV | µV |
|---|---|---|
| AA alkaline cell | 0.0015 kV | 1.5e+06 µV |
| USB bus | 0.005 kV | 5e+06 µV |
| Car battery | 0.0126 kV | 1.26e+07 µV |
| UK mains | 0.23 kV | 2.3e+08 µV |
| US mains | 0.12 kV | 1.2e+08 µV |
| Overhead distribution line | 11 kV | 1.1e+10 µV |
Published reference values, converted with the same factor this page uses.
